Boeing Secures $75 Million Contract for Long-Range Precision-Guided Munitions
The US Air Force has awarded Boeing a $75 million contract to acquire the BSU-111/B PDU Joint Direct Attack Munition Long Range (JDAM LR), a precision-guided munition. The JDAM LR combines existing JDAM infrastructure with a wing kit and compact turbojet engine, enabling high-volume production and rapid integration with any aircraft capable of carrying conventional JDAM.
According to Boeing's vice president Bob Ciesla, the first production contract is a major milestone for the JDAM LR programme. 'This demonstrates our ability to deliver long-range precision-strike capability at a significantly lower cost,' said Ciesla.
The system recently completed its first flight test off the coast of California, meeting the objectives of sustaining powered flight on a predefined test profile and using military-code GPS navigation while maintaining consistent guidance directly to its target.
